Octane’s upcoming Stim nerf in Apex Legends: What players need to know

The Current State of Octane

Octane has established himself as a top-tier Legend in Apex Legends’ current meta. His Stim ability provides unparalleled mobility, allowing for aggressive pushes and quick escapes that few other characters can match. The current version costs just 12 health points for a substantial speed boost that lasts 6 seconds, with a 4-second cooldown between uses.

What makes Octane particularly strong is how his passive health regeneration offsets the Stim’s cost. At higher skill levels, players have mastered chaining Stim uses with tactical positioning, making him nearly impossible to pin down in combat situations.

Planned Changes to Stim

Respawn Entertainment has confirmed significant adjustments coming to Octane’s Stim in Season 9. The health cost will jump from 12 to 20 damage per use, while the cooldown between activations will be drastically reduced to just 1 second. This represents a 66% increase in health expenditure but allows for more frequent activation.

Developer comments suggest this change aims to maintain Octane’s identity as the game’s speedster while introducing more risk to his aggressive playstyle. The shorter cooldown preserves his mobility options but forces players to carefully consider each Stim activation due to the heavier health penalty.

Impact on Gameplay

These changes will significantly alter how Octane is played at all skill levels. The increased health cost means players can’t spam Stim as freely during engagements, requiring more strategic use of the ability. However, the reduced cooldown opens up new movement tech possibilities for skilled players.

Community reaction has been mixed. While many players welcome the nerf to Octane’s escape potential, some mains worry the changes might make him too punishing to play effectively. Data shows Octane currently appears in over 25% of matches, a statistic Respawn aims to reduce while keeping him viable.

Adapting to the Changes

Octane players will need to develop new strategies to accommodate the higher health costs. Prioritizing shield cells over syringes becomes more important, as Stim will deplete health faster. Timing activations to coincide with natural cover becomes crucial to avoid being caught vulnerable.

Advanced techniques like stim-jump chaining will still be possible but require precise health management. Pairing Octane with support Legends like Lifeline or Gibraltar may become more popular to offset the increased health expenditure. The changes ultimately reward calculated aggression over reckless speed.
